Born in Seattle, Washington, and raised in Norfolk, Virginia, Ishibashi studied film scoring at Berklee College of Music before embarking on a career in music. He first gained attention as a violinist for the indie rock band Jupiter One and later as a touring musician with the likes of Regina Spektor and Sondre Lerche.
